Mountain Dew and Robert Rodriguez seeking for “passionate” video content

Mountain Dew has teamed up with acclaimed film director Robert Rodriguez for its Green Label Studios: Open Call project that invites aspiring filmmakers to win a production grant of $250,000. This money will be used by the winner to develop content for Green-Label.com, the youth culture-themed online platform launched by Mountain Dew and Complex Media back in spring 2013.

The submission period runs through April 25 on www.Green-Label.com. Entrants are invited to share their videos, which revolve around the “Do the DEW” theme and celebrate their passions. The entries will be reviewed and judged by a panel of experts from the Mountain Dew and Green-Label.com editorial teams. They will shortlist 10 finalists, each of them getting a $10,000 production grant to shoot a stunning clip for DEW. Their films will be screened before the judges in summer in NYC.

The overall winner will walk away with a $250,000 production grant to develop truly valuable content for the DEW’s youth-themed lifestyle platform. In addition, she or he will get an opportunity to be mentored by Robert Rodriguez as well as film and television writer and producer Roberto Orci.

“I believe that each of us has a story to tell—and that inspiration and the ability to tell those stories creatively can spark in anyone, at any time,” commented Robert Rodriquez at a Green Label Studios event at SXSW. “I’m excited to partner with DEW to give professional and aspiring storytellers and creators a creative outlet to share with us their stories.”
